Tinubu appoints Enugu former speaker member UNN Governing Council

President Bola Tinubu has appointed former Speaker of the Enugu state House of Assembly, Rt. Hon. Eugene Odo, member of the newly reconstituted Governing Council of the University of Nigeria, Nsukka (UNN).

Odo was named the South East representative in a list of key appointments released on Monday, May 27, 2025, by Bayo Onanuga, Special Adviser to the President on Information and Strategy.

This significant appointment comes as part of the President’s renewed efforts to reposition federal tertiary institutions for excellence and global competitiveness. Rt. Hon. Eugene Odo, a seasoned lawmaker and grassroots leader, is expected to bring his wealth of experience in governance, law, and public policy to bear on the development of Nigeria’s premier indigenous university.

Born and raised in Ukehe, Igbo Etiti Local Government A of Enugu State, Ozor, Ebube Ukehe is renowned for his astute leadership, legislative acumen, and commitment to educational advancement.

His appointment has been widely celebrated in Enugu and beyond.
